A psychological thriller is similar to a thriller in terms of what it does and the types of scene that occur, however a character or some fo the characters suffer from psychological difference that influence their judgement and who they are. Examples of this include:
Dualism- this is when a character has a split personality, their minds are not of one person and as a result characters that have a dual nature find it difficult to tell reality from fiction.
Ontology- this is when a person tries to determine what actually exists, similarly to dualism characters is unable to tell what is physical and what is a fabrication of their minds.

The themes which are usually involved in a psychological thriller are:
• Mind
• Perception
• Identity
• Death
• Existence
